Standard Test Conditions (STC) of a Photovoltaic Panel

The power (current x voltage) output of a photovoltaic (PV) panel under these standard test conditions is often referred to as "peak watts" or "Wp". There is a particular point on the I-V curve of a PV panel called the Maximum Power Point (MPP), at which the panel operates at maximum efficiency and produces its maximum output power.

Solar Photovoltaic Technology Basics

What is photovoltaic (PV) technology and how does it work? PV materials and devices convert sunlight into electrical energy. A single PV device is known as a cell. An individual PV cell is usually small, typically producing about 1 or 2 watts of power. These cells are made of different semiconductor materials and are often less than the thickness of four human hairs.

Solar panel

Solar array mounted on a rooftop. A solar panel is a device that converts sunlight into electricity by using photovoltaic (PV) cells. PV cells are made of materials that produce excited electrons when exposed to light. The electrons flow through a circuit and produce direct current (DC) electricity, which can be used to power various devices or be stored in batteries.

Are solar panels good for the environment?

“Having crops and solar panels is more beneficial for the environment than solar panels alone.” This kind of setup also cools the solar panels in two ways: Water evaporating from the soil rises up towards the panels, and plants release their own water.

What crops are grown under solar panels?

To study these differences, we grow a slew of different crops underneath solar panels. We grow tomatoes, basil, potatoes, beans, squash, and lavender, just to name a few. While some of the plants grown at B2AVSLL are heat tolerant, crops grown in this region of the U.S. still require a lot of water.
